PTSD is a mental health condition that can develop after experiencing a traumatic event, such as combat, natural disasters, or serious accidents. For veterans who have served in combat zones, the prevalence of PTSD is particularly high, as they are exposed to intense and life-threatening situations on a daily basis. The symptoms of PTSD can vary from person to person but often include flashbacks, nightmares, severe anxiety, and feelings of guilt or shame.

In the Bronx, many veterans are struggling to cope with the effects of PTSD, leading to challenges in their daily lives. From difficulties holding down a job to strained relationships with loved ones, the impact of PTSD can be far-reaching and devastating. Despite the prevalence of PTSD among veterans, there is still a stigma surrounding mental health issues in the military community, making it difficult for veterans to seek the help they desperately need.

One organization working to combat this stigma and provide support for veterans with PTSD in the Bronx is the Veterans Health Administration (VHA). The VHA offers a wide range of mental health services specifically designed for veterans, including individual therapy, group counseling, and medication management. Additionally, the VHA has a number of specialized programs for veterans with PTSD, such as the National Center for PTSD and the Vet Centers, which provide confidential counseling and support services to veterans and their families.

In addition to the VHA, there are a number of community organizations in the Bronx that are dedicated to supporting veterans with PTSD. One such organization is the Bronx Veterans Center, which offers a variety of mental health services, peer support groups, and wellness activities for veterans in the area. The Bronx Veterans Center also provides outreach and education on PTSD to help raise awareness and reduce the stigma surrounding mental health issues in the military community.
